What is the First Indemnity Insurance Group Property/General Liability Application?
The First Indemnity Insurance Group Property/General Liability Application serves as a critical document for businesses seeking property and general liability insurance coverage. This application captures essential information about the applicant's business, enabling insurance providers to assess risks and determine appropriate policy terms.
Understanding the purpose and function of this application is vital, as it directly impacts the insurance underwriting process. A well-completed property general liability insurance application can streamline approval, ensuring businesses receive coverage that meets their specific needs.

Eligibility Criteria for the Application
Eligibility for the First Indemnity Insurance Group Property/General Liability Application typically encompasses various types of businesses. To apply, businesses must meet specific criteria, which can vary based on the industry and coverage needs.
-
Small to medium-sized businesses looking for comprehensive liability coverage.
-
Companies operating in sectors that require property insurance for physical assets.
-
Organizations with a clean claims history are typically favored.
Understanding the eligibility requirements helps potential applicants determine if they qualify to use this application and aids in tailoring their submission accordingly.

Required Documents and Supporting Materials
When submitting the First Indemnity Insurance Group application, it's crucial to include specific supporting documents to enhance your application’s completeness. Gather the necessary materials in advance to streamline your submission process.
-
Proof of business registration and identification.
-
Financial statements that demonstrate operational stability.
-
Existing insurance policies, if applicable, to provide context.
Having these documents ready can significantly improve your application’s success rates and processing time.
